Digital Desk: The legendary Indian bowler Mohammed Shami is set to win the Arjuna Award for his exceptional cricket performance. The Ministry of Youth Affairs & Sports has announced the National Sports Awards 2023 today. At a specially arranged event at Rashtrapati Bhavan on January 9, 2024, he will receive the award from the President of India together with the other recipients. 

Shami is one of 26 athletes from India to get the Arjuna Award for outstanding achievement in 2023. Award winners of the Arjuna Award are those who performed exceptionally over the four previous years and have shown leadership, sportsmanship, and discipline.

The 33-year-old had a tremendous tournament in the 2023 ODI World Cup, when India placed second losing to Australia in the final match. In just seven matches, he claimed 24 wickets, making him the World Cup's top wicket-taker.
